以下是使用C语言编写的100-999范围内的质数打印程序:
c语言编程入门指南pdf
c复制代码
#include<stdio.h>
int main() {
int i, j;
for (i = 100; i <= 999; i++) {
int is_prime = 1;
for (j = 2; j <= i / 2; j++) {
if (i % j == 0) {
is_prime = 0;
break;
}
}
if (is_prime == 1) {
printf("%d ", i);
}
}
return0;
}
该程序使用两个嵌套的循环来检查100-999范围内的每个数字是否为质数。外部循环从100到999遍历每个数字,内部循环从2到该数字的一半遍历每个可能的除数,检查该数字是否可以被整除。如果该数字可以被整除,则将其标记为非质数,并跳出内部循环。最后,如果该数字未被标记为非质数,则将其打印出来。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。